What Role Do Adjustable Beds Play in Alleviating Breathing Sounds and Sleep Apnea?

Elevating the torso during sleep can greatly reduce snoring and alleviate symptoms of sleep apnea. Adjustable beds enable users to adjust their rest posture, which can be particularly advantageous for those affected by these conditions. By lifting the head and upper body, air circulation through the airways is improved, minimizing the vibrations that cause snoring. This position also assists to stop the tongue and soft tissues from collapsing into the throat, a common problem in sleep apnea.

In addition, customized bed solutions can render a more comfortable sleeping environment, which catalyzes better sleep quality. Users can experiment with different angles to determine the most effective position for their individual needs. This malleability not only fosters a more restful night but may also strengthen overall health by reducing the instances of sleep disruptions. Henceforth, purchasing an flexible mattress platform may be a practical solution for individuals struggling with snoring and sleep apnea.

The Positive Effects of Customizable Beds for Cardiovascular Function and Pain Relief

Elevating the extremities and upper torso in a customized position can greatly enhance circulation and ease discomfort for plenty of people. Modifiable beds allow for perfect physical positioning, supporting healthier circulation and reducing pressure on essential areas. This improved circulation can help individuals with conditions such as arthritis or chronic pain, as it reduces soreness and promotes total wellness.

Elevating the legs can also reduce swelling in the lower extremities, assisting those with edema or varicose veins. Additionally, a higher upper body position can reduce pressure on the spine, potentially easing back pain and enhancing spinal alignment.

Furthermore, adjustable beds allow for personalized adjustments, catering to each person's distinct requirements. As a result, users often experience not only relief from current discomfort but also enhanced comfort during sleep. The combination of improved circulation and pain relief highlights the significant benefits of investing in an adjustable bed for a healthier lifestyle.

Relief of Pain

Relieving discomfort is a major benefit of choosing an adjustable bed, particularly for those dealing with chronic pain. By enabling users to adjust their sleeping posture, these beds can alleviate pressure on vulnerable spots, such as the back, neck, and joints. Individuals with conditions like arthritis, fibromyalgia, or lower back pain may find substantial relief by elevating their legs or raising their upper body. This personalized support can lead to better spinal alignment, reducing strain during sleep. Additionally, an adjustable bed can help minimize discomfort associated with acid reflux, as elevating the head can reduce gastric issues. Overall, the potential for pain alleviation makes adjustable beds a valuable option for enhancing long-term health and well-being.

Improved Vascular Gains

While many may not right away think about sleep position's impact on circulation, investing in an adjustable bed can significantly improve blood flow. By allowing users to elevate their legs or upper body, these beds facilitate better venous return, decreasing the risk of blood pooling in the extremities. Better blood flow benefits overall health, promoting faster recovery from injuries and reducing fatigue. Additionally, improved circulation can relieve symptoms of conditions such as varicose veins and edema. Long-term use of adjustable beds may lead to healthier cardiovascular function, guaranteeing that essential organs receive adequate oxygen and nutrients. Consequently, the advantages extend beyond comfort, adding to sustained well-being and a better quality of life for those seeking restorative sleep.

Will adjustable Beds accommodate Multiple Mattress Types?

Yes, adjustable beds can support different mattress types, like memory foam, latex, and innerspring. Each type must meet specific adaptability standards to ensure compatibility, allowing users to experience personalized support and comfort while adjusting the bed's position.

Do Adjustable Beds Require Special Bedding or Coverings?

Adjustable beds do not invariably demand specialized sheets or covers, but fitted sheets made for deeper mattresses can optimize fit performance. Conventional bedding may also work, though it might not secure as securely on adjustable bed platforms.

What Decibel Level Do Adjustable Bed Components Produce?

Adjustable bed components can vary in noise production; some operate without disturbance while others may make observable sounds during adjustments. Generally, newer models tend to be engineered for quieter function, minimizing interruptions during use.

Are Adjustable Beds Easy to Construct and Transport?

Adjustable beds are generally easy to put together and relocate, often requiring minimal equipment and work. Their lightweight components and modular structure facilitate moving, making them a practical option for those who may frequently change settings.

What Determines the Mean Lifespan of an Adjustable Bed?

The standard life span of an adjustable bed commonly ranges from 10 to 15 years, affected by conditions including how often it's used, material durability, and preventative maintenance. Regular attention can improve its service life notably.
